Designed by
Title
Virgin and Child stained glass window, Saint Edmundsbury Cathedral, Millennium Projects 11 - "Spirit and Faith" serie, circa 2000 #116031355
Description
MOSCOW, RUSSIA - MARCH 18, 2018: A stamp printed in Great Britain shows Virgin and Child stained glass window, Saint Edmundsbury Cathedral, Millennium Projects 11 - Spirit and Faith serie, circa 2000
This image is editorial